El Dorado High
1651 North Valencia Ave.
Placentia, CA 92670-3030

(714) 993-5350

Grade Range: 9-12
Enrollment: 2410
Full-Time Teachers: 90
Students per Teacher: 27
WWhite/Non-Hispanic 77.5%
BBlack/Non-Hispanic 1.3%
HHispanic 13.1%
AAsian/Pacific Islander 7.9%
NAmerican Indian/Alaska Native 0.2%
Ethnicity Data Source (2006)
